Josรฉ Raรบl Capablanca was the third world chess champion (1921-1927). He is widely accepted as one of the greatest players of all time. During an 8 year period spanning from 1916-1924, Capablanca did not lose a single tournament game! His record of 40 wins and 23 draws over this period (where he also became world champion) was unprecedented.
